Filming Emily in Paris: locations and how to visit
Some shows use a city as scenery; this one casts Paris as a leading character. Between the cafés, the cobbles and the gilt, the series turns the French capital into a glossy daydream, which is exactly why so many viewers finish an episode itching to book a flight. The best part for set-jetters: the locations are real, central and close enough to string together on foot.
Everything orbits the Latin Quarter's Place de l'Estrapade, the quiet square that holds the heroine's apartment building and the corner restaurant below it. From there the show fans out across the city, the gilt and grand staircase of the Palais Garnier opera house, the lamp-lit ornament of the Pont Alexandre III over the Seine, the arcades and striped columns of the Jardin du Palais-Royal, and the brass-and-banquette glamour of the Café de Flore in Saint-Germain. Every one of them sits in Paris, France.
This is the rare guide you can walk in an afternoon. Start at Place de l'Estrapade, drift down toward the river for the Pont Alexandre III, then cross to the Right Bank for the Palais-Royal and the opera house, finishing with a coffee at the Café de Flore. Go early to beat the crowds at the most-photographed corners, and wear shoes you can actually cover the cobbles in.

Place de l'Estrapade
This quiet Latin Quarter square is home to the building used for Emily's apartment, and the corner restaurant on it stands in for the bistro downstairs.

Palais Garnier
The 19th-century opera house, all gilt and grand staircase, recurs across the series as the city's most theatrical backdrop.

Pont Alexandre III
The most ornate bridge in Paris, gilded statues, lamp posts and all, turns up in the series' romantic and establishing beats over the Seine.

Jardin du Palais-Royal
The arcaded royal garden, and the striped Buren columns in its forecourt, feature as one of Emily's elegant Right Bank strolls.

Café de Flore
The storied Saint-Germain café, all red banquettes and brass, is one of the Paris institutions Emily drifts through between work and romance.
